How they compare
Saint Lucia currently reports 10.5% against 9.8% in Guinea-Bissau, a difference of 0.7%.
That makes Saint Lucia's figure about 1.1 times Guinea-Bissau's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Saint Lucia ahead.
Guinea-Bissau ranks 183rd and Saint Lucia ranks 181st of 210 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Guinea-Bissau averaged higher in 1 and Saint Lucia in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Guinea-Bissau | Saint Lucia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 10.8% | 10.5% | 0.3% | Guinea-Bissau |
| 2010s | 12.4% | 15.6% | 3.2% | Saint Lucia |
| 2020s | 12.4% | 12.9% | 0.4% | Saint Lucia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
